Transaction 40e37f6bdc3c413b5dd319c8419e7cc5bae43cd596ed41afdf43d6d7528eb176

1 Input
2 Outputs
  • 40e37f6bdc3c413b5dd319c8419e7cc5bae43cd596ed41afdf43d6d7528eb176:0
  • value  956358
    address  196f3X79ianB66pzrGEK9nZqUVgEkmuLG6
  • 40e37f6bdc3c413b5dd319c8419e7cc5bae43cd596ed41afdf43d6d7528eb176:1
  • value  5596198737
    address  1EQWHEZuy4oeGJtg5XeVKRR7nEmMLNZGeJ